Output 5d2d0bb31c8870f644a9ffa53e33e76f71806e4ee2f309d34802c1ab00a41b08:1

value
306210329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1dcf3e07e9e6721f34d4461841f047134c91da OP_EQUAL
address
38dUzKs2pC6dSvH1Bj6eTzMqtHCpH2SeC5
transaction
5d2d0bb31c8870f644a9ffa53e33e76f71806e4ee2f309d34802c1ab00a41b08
confirmations
503433
spent
true